NASHUA PET CARE CLINIC TEAM
VETERINARIAN-- PAUL H. PHENIX, DVM
Dr. Phenix and his wife, Ingrid, have 2 children, Sarah and Todd as well as a first grandchild, Hannah. He began his life as a veterinarian in Sturbridge, Ma. From there he moved to Milford, NH and now practices in Nashua, NH at his new location. His menagerie includes his 2 potcakes, Bee and Maggie (Clinic Mascots) as well as Rosie--the feline household social director. He is an active member of the following veterinary organizations.AVMA (American Veterinary Medical Association)
AAHA (American Animal Hospital Association)
AVDS (American Veterinary Dental Society)
AAV (Association of Avian Veterinarians)
ARAV (Association of Reptilian & Amphibian Veterinarians)
AEMV (Association of Exotic Mammal Veterinarians)
